Roses have also other color variations such as yellow, peach, lavender, green, and blue roses. Yellow roses known as friendship flowers often referred to warmth and ... WebPurple Rose Meaning. Purple or Lavender Roses are symbols of a highly spiritual love, such as soul mates share. Purple is the color of the 7th or Crown Chakra which represents our most psychic self, our connection to heaven. The color purple is the color of royalty and wealth.
